A VoIP phone, short for Voice over Internet Protocol phone, is a type of phone that uses an internet connection to make and receive calls, as opposed to using a traditional landline. VoIP phones can be either hardware-based or software-based. Hardware-based VoIP phones are physical devices that connect to your router or modem, while software-based VoIP phones are apps that you can install on your computer, smartphone, or tablet.
VoIP phones offer a number of advantages over traditional landlines, including lower costs, more features, and greater flexibility. VoIP calls are typically much cheaper than landline calls, especially for long-distance and international calls. VoIP phones also offer a wider range of features than landlines, such as call waiting, caller ID, voicemail, and conferencing. And because VoIP phones are not tied to a physical location, you can take them with you wherever you go.
An IP phone, also known as an Internet Protocol phone, is a type of telephone that uses the Internet Protocol (IP) to transmit voice and data over a computer network. IP phones can be used to make and receive calls to and from traditional landlines, as well as to other IP phones. IP phones offer a number of advantages over traditional landlines, including lower costs, greater flexibility, and more features.
One of the main advantages of IP phones is that they can be used to make calls over the Internet, which can save businesses and consumers money on long-distance and international calls. IP phones also offer greater flexibility than traditional landlines, as they can be used anywhere there is an Internet connection. Additionally, IP phones typically offer a wider range of features than traditional landlines, such as voicemail, caller ID, and call forwarding.

Web Real-Time Communication (WebRTC) is an open-source project that provides browsers and mobile applications with real-time communication capabilities. This technology enables the exchange of audio, video, and data between peers without the need for third-party plugins or intermediaries. It is supported by major web browsers such as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, and Safari, as well as mobile operating systems Android and iOS.
WebRTC offers several benefits, including reduced latency, improved security, and lower costs compared to traditional communication methods. It is widely used for video conferencing, online gaming, and other real-time applications. Additionally, WebRTC plays a crucial role in the development of next-generation communication technologies, such as voice over IP (VoIP) and unified communications (UC), by providing a standardized and interoperable platform for real-time communication.

A SIP proxy server is a network component that forwards SIP (Session Initiation Protocol) messages between VoIP (Voice over IP) endpoints. It acts as an intermediary between two or more SIP devices, facilitating the establishment, modification, and termination of SIP sessions.
SIP proxy servers play a crucial role in VoIP communications by providing a range of essential functions. They can perform address resolution, translating user-friendly addresses into IP addresses. They also provide session management, establishing and maintaining SIP sessions, and routing requests to appropriate endpoints. Additionally, SIP proxy servers can offer security features such as authentication, encryption, and firewall protection, ensuring the privacy and integrity of VoIP communications.

Session Initiation Protocol (SIP) phones are IP phones that use the SIP to establish, maintain, and terminate multimedia communication sessions. They are an alternative to traditional analog phones and can offer a number of advantages, including lower costs, increased flexibility, and improved features.
SIP phones are typically used in business environments, but they can also be used in residential settings. Voicemail is an automated telephone answering system that allows callers to leave a recorded message for the recipient to retrieve at their convenience. Voicemail systems are typically used in situations where the recipient is unavailable to answer the phone in person, such as when they are out of the office or on vacation.
